Embraer Phenom 300 for sale / Range: around 1,970 nm / Passengers: typically 6–8.
The Phenom 300 is one of the closest newer-generation alternatives. It has newer avionics and a modern cabin, while the Learjet 45/45XR remains attractive for buyers who value Learjet speed and the used-aircraft price point.
Learjet 60 / 60XR for sale / Range: around 2,000–2,400 nm, depending on variant and assumptions / Passengers: typically 6–8.
This is the natural step up within the Learjet family. The 60 gives the buyer more performance and cabin capability, but it is a larger and heavier aircraft with different operating economics.
Citation Sovereign / Range: around 3,000 nm or more, depending on variant / Passengers: typically 8–12.
The Sovereign is a much more capable aircraft for longer missions. It belongs on the comparison list when the Learjet 45's range becomes the limiting factor rather than the cabin size.
Citation Latitude for sale / Range: around 2,400 nm / Passengers: typically 8-9.
A newer-generation alternative with a stand-up cabin and modern avionics. It is considerably larger in overall capability, but the comparison is relevant for an owner moving from an older Learjet into a newer midsize jet.
Learjet 40 / 40XR for sale / Range: roughly 1,700-2,000 nm - Passengers: typically 6–8.
The Learjet 40 is the closest sibling and shares much of the 45's operating concept. The main difference is cabin length: the 45 gives passengers more usable interior space.
